Why method is the first criterion
A comparison that starts with features buries the load-bearing question: is the measurement spatially honest? Per-point geo-grid sampling estimates the rank surface; single-point checks report one coordinate as if it were the whole area. Everything else a tool does — listings, reviews, citations, reporting — is downstream of what it measures. Hence this page's ordering.

Reading the table methodologically
Three of the four implement geo-grid scanning; scope separates them next. BrightLocal and Whitespark bundle the measurement with listings, review or citation tooling; Local Falcon and LocalRank concentrate on the measurement itself. Choosing under uncertainty
Method first: verify per-point sampling, per the pipeline in how local rank tracking works. Scope second: consolidation buyers evaluate suites; measurement-only buyers evaluate specialists. Price third: entry pricing matters because agency and multi-location economics multiply it. Verify current plan details on each vendor's official site — comparison pages, this one included, age.
